Okay, my title might be undescriptive, let me try to explain it better. I want
to take a script I've written and make it usable by typing its name in the
terminal. Perfect example is the python interpreter. You just type in the word
python to the terminal and then the interpreter runs. I know other programs can
do this as well (like mozilla or nautilus or rhythmbox). So how do I make my
scripts executable from the terminal?
